RHSA-2021:1079: Moderate: Red Hat Ansible Automation Platform Operator 1.2 security update
Red Hat Ansible Automation Platform Resource Operator container images with security fixes.Ansible Automation Platform manages Ansible Platform jobs and workflowsthat can interface with any infrastructure on a Red Hat OpenShift ContainerPlatform cluster, or on a traditional infrastructure that is runningoff-cluster.Security fixes:CVE-2021-20191 ansible: multiple modules expose secured values [ansibleautomationplatform-1.2] (BZ#1916813)CVE-2021-20178 ansible: user data leak in snmpfacts module [ansibleautomationplatform-1.2] (BZ#1914774)CVE-2021-20180 ansible: ansible module: bitbucketpipelinevariable exposes secured values [ansibleautomationplatform-1.2] (BZ#1915808)CVE-2021-20228 ansible: basic.py nolog with fallback option [ansibleautomationplatform-1.2] (BZ#1925002)CVE-2021-3447 ansible: multiple modules expose secured values [ansibleautomationplatform-1.2] (BZ#1939349)For more details about the security issue, including the impact, a CVSSscore, acknowledgments, and other related information, refer to the CVEpage(s) listed in the References section.
